This study aims to determine the relation of species diversity of trees in the environmental condition
of Navotas City.
BACKGROUND OF Specifically, this study seeks to answer the following questions:
1.What are the species of trees that are present in different barangays of Navotas City?
THE STUDY A. Cluster 1: San Rafael Village, North Bay Boulevard South Proper, North Bay Boulevard South
Dagat-Dagatan, North Bay Boulevard South Kaunlaran, North Bay Boulevard North, Bangkulasi
B. Cluster 2: Bagumbayan South, Bagumbayan North, Navotas East, Navotas West
C. Cluster 3: Tangos 1, Tangos 2, San Roque, San Jose, Daanghari, Sipac Almacen
CONCEPTUAL D. Cluster 4: Tanza 1, Tanza 2
FRAMEWORK 2.How does the abundance of trees relate to its quality based on their location?
A. Fishponds
B. Residential
C. Industrial
STATEMENT OF THE
PROBLEM 3.How does the species diversity of trees relate to the environmental condition of Navotas City?
1. Seasonal flooding
2. Air pollution
3. Humidity

SCOPE AND
DELIMITATIONS
This study intends to identify the many tree species that are still present in
Navotas City's several barangays. In addition, this study will determine the
DEFINITION OF TERMS relation of abundance of tree species that are present in public areas of
Navotas City in relation to their physical appearance based on their location.
This study focuses on how the species of trees relate to the environmental
condition when it comes to seasonal flooding, air pollution, and humidity in
Navotas City.
METHODOLOGICAL
FLOW CHART The limitation of this study is that the researchers will not include the private
sectors in the City of Navotas. This study will not determine the age of the
trees. This study may not include other cities.

Definition of Terms
Abundance. The number of an organism's species in a habitat. A species'
DEFINITION OF TERMS geographic distribution is referred to as distribution.
Environmental Condition. The environment's quality and condition are
an unavoidable aspect of daily life that can have an impact on health.
Weather, air quality, and other environmental factors frequently differ
METHODOLOGICAL between populations and geographical regions.
Humidity. A measurement of the air's water vapor content. In relation to
FLOW CHART the maximum amount of water vapor, relative humidity quantifies the
amount of water in the air. (moisture). The amount of water vapor that the
air can contain increases with temperature.
Species Diversity. The total number of species found in an environment
and the relative abundance of each species.
